• Overview of IoT and its roadmap, Opportunities
& Challenges in implementing IoT Solutions.
CC3200 Platform, Value Line
Architecture, Features and Peripherals.
• Connectivity Solutions using CC3200 Wi-Fi –
Accessing HTML Page from HTTP Web Server.
WLAN connection in Access Point Mode
& Station Mode and Introduction to Energia IDE
• Working with: Serial Interface,
Wireless interface (RF), Multiple peripherals
as a system. Creation of own Web
Server and Web page. Exercise on web server
with different web pages to control the Hardware
• Working with MQTT protocol and pushing the sensor
data to the IBM cloud. Configuring MQTT client
and server using web browser and Android APP.
Data acquisition and control using the cloud
server with the user interface as Mobile APP
and web browser. Working with eclipse.org cloud server
• Getting weather information from cloud server
using CC3200Wi-Fi. Working with Temboo
and Yahoo cloud server
• Getting Time information from cloud server
using CC3200 Wi-Fi. Sending Email from the Hardware
CC3200 using Google mail cloud server.
Sending SMS alerts using Nexmo and
Twilio cloud services. Getting connected
with Thingspeak Cloud platform and sending
sensor information.
• Getting connected with AT&T Cloud
platform and sending sensor information.
Updating real time user location to AT&T
cloud platform with map visualization.
